Subject: [dpdk-dev] RHEL 7 support
Date: Fri, 09 Jul 2021 20:33:28 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<2874531.2S3dPSLiCe@thomas> (raw)

Hi,

I would like to open a discussion about RHEL 7 support in DPDK.
How long do we want to support it in new DPDK versions?
Can we drop RHEL 7 support starting DPDK 21.11?

If we decide to drop RHEL 7 support, does it mean we can generally use
standard C11 atomics?

What other benefits or impacts can you think about?
